Nagpur: Dr Harssh Poddar, Superintendent of Police (SP), Nagpur Rural, has been selected among the top five officers in the final results of the prestigious Mid-Career Training Programme (MCTP) conducted at the National Police Academy (NPA), Hyderabad.
The achievement marks a proud moment for the Nagpur Rural Police Department. The programme is designed for officers in the ranks of Superintendent of Police to Deputy Inspector General of Police in the Indian Police Service. It focuses on the latest innovations in policing, technology and administrative practices.
This year’s edition of the training was held from April 21 to May 17, at the NPA, Hyderabad and 82 officers from across India participated. SP Dr Poddar represented Maharashtra along with other senior officers, having been nominated by the State Government for the programme. On June 9, the NPA declared the final results of the training, in which Dr Poddar was recognised for his exceptional performance.
